> Do you want me use call like bellow API with register names:
> CCI_REG16_LE(0x30d8);
> cci_write();
> cci_multi_reg_write();
> devm_cci_regmap_init_i2c();


Yes please, I would want that very much. I'm not very good at reading
and storing hex values in my head! That's why I broke down the above
registers to strings and decimal values.


The discussions at
https://lore.kernel.org/all/PH0PR11MB5611FD22CF6E12F7226FA9C081E12@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x/
reports the full datasheet, and I stated:


> > > This is an enormous amount of duplicated data that could be factored
> > > out.
> > >
> > > These are also /very/ common against the existing mode register
> > > tables too.
> > >
> > > I think several things need to happen in this driver:
> > >
> > > 1. It should be converted to use the CCI helpers.
> > > 2. Whereever identifiable, the register names should be used
> > > instead of
> > > just the addresses.
> > > 3. The common factors of these tables should be de-duplicated.
> > >
> > > In your additions you only have differences in the following
> > > registers from those entire tables:

You replied with

> >
> > I will try to optimize camera resolution array register value usage by
> > writing common register array values.

which you have done (point 3), and is great progress in the series.

Further down in the thread I stated:


> > > 4. And ideally - the differences which determine the modes should
> > > be
> > > factored out to calculations so that we are not writing out
> > > large
> > > tables just to write a parameterised frame size.
> > >
> > >
> > > I would beleive that at least steps 1 and 3 would be achievable, 2
> > > and 4 would depend upon access to the datasheet.
> > >


I still believe steps 1 is important to this development. You have done
step 3 I think. And now both step 2 and (later) step 4 are possible as we
have the datasheet.
